Zingst

Another amazing place I enjoyed on the Northern Baltic Sea. Zingst is the most eastern point on the Darss peninsula. Zingst Peninsula extends eastward about 20 kilometres and has a width of just 2 to 4 kilometres which makes it really easy walking and cycling. There are dyke's running the entire length and width of the peninsula. You can rent bikes (very cheap!) for as long as you like, by the hour, day, week, month! whatever you like.
There are some really cool "dunes" that border the Baltic Sea and a bird sanctuary for cranes.
